Brake Pad 1


  • Function
    • To turn mechanical energy into thermal energy
    • To stop the wheel from turning
    • Presses against brake disc to stop scooter
  • Material
    • Steel
    • Aluminum
    • Rubber

  • Reasons for Material Selection
    • Durability for increased safety
    • Aluminum for parts that do not need extreme durability
    • Pad material to disperse heat effectively
    • Pad material with high coefficient of friction
    • Pad material cannot wear down easily
  • Forces Applied to the Component
    • Pulling force from the brake line which comes from the handlebar brakes
    • Compressions force against the brake disc and normal force against the disc
  • Choice of Manufacturing Process
    • Threading to put threads on the screws
    • Die Casting best option for difficult complex items that need to be mass manufactured
    • Milling because it is cheap to mill aluminum and steel and also easy
